Architectural Grandeur and Innovation
Built in 1911, the Crawford W. Brazell House is a stunning example of Classical Revival architecture, a style characterized by its grandeur and adherence to symmetry. This architectural approach was a nod to the Renaissance and ancient Greek and Roman designs, which were believed to embody ideals of beauty and rationality. Walking through its stately entrance, visitors are greeted by massive columns and intricately carved moldings that showcase the mastery of craftsmanship from a bygone era. The house stands as a testament to the architectural ambition of its time, blending functionality with artistry in a seamless manner.
